The cost of screening recycled aggregate is influenced by several factors, including the type of material being processed, the scale of operations, and the equipment used. Recycled aggregate, derived from construction and demolition waste, requires thorough screening to remove contaminants and ensure uniformity in particle size. This process is critical for meeting industry standards and ensuring the material's suitability for reuse in construction projects.

One of the primary cost drivers is the type of screening equipment employed. Vibrating screens, trommel screens, and air classifiers are commonly used, each with varying efficiency levels and operational costs. Vibrating screens are often preferred for their high throughput and ability to handle large volumes, but they may require significant maintenance. Trommel screens are suitable for wet or sticky materials but can be less efficient for fine grading. Air classifiers are ideal for lightweight contaminants but come with higher energy costs.

Labor costs also play a significant role in the overall expense. Skilled operators are needed to monitor the screening process, adjust settings, and perform maintenance. Additionally, the location of the recycling facility impacts costs due to variations in labor wages, transportation fees, and local regulations. Facilities in urban areas may face higher operational expenses compared to those in rural regions.

The quality of the incoming recycled material affects screening efficiency and costs. Contaminated or poorly sorted waste requires more intensive processing, increasing time and resource consumption. Pre-sorting at demolition sites can reduce these costs by minimizing unwanted debris before it reaches the screening stage.

Finally, market demand for recycled aggregate influences pricing. In regions with high demand for sustainable construction materials, the cost of screening may be offset by higher selling prices. Conversely, areas with limited demand may struggle to justify extensive screening investments.

Understanding these factors helps recyclers optimize their operations and manage expenses effectively. By investing in efficient equipment, training skilled labor, and improving material quality at the source, businesses can reduce screening costs while maintaining high standards for recycled aggregate.
